#341553 Hex Color Code

#341553

The Hexadecimal Color #341553 is a contrast shade of Midnight Blue. #341553 RGB value is rgb(52, 21, 83). RGB Color Model of #341553 consists of 20% red, 8% green and 32% blue. HSL color Mode of #341553 has 270°(degrees) Hue, 60% Saturation and 20% Lightness. #341553 color has an wavelength of 450n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#341553 is #663366.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#341553 is #315. The Closest Color to #341553 is #191970. Official Name of #341553 Hex Code is Grape.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#341553 is 37 Cyan 75 Magenta 0 Yellow 67 Black and #341553 CMY is 37, 75,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#341553 is hsl(270,60,20,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(270, 75, 33).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#341553 is 3.25, 1.89, 8.38.
Hex8 Value of #341553 is #341553FF. Decimal Value of #341553 is 3413331 and Octal Value of #341553 is 15012523. Binary Value of #341553 is 110100, 10101, 1010011 and Android of #341553 is 4281603411 / 0xff341553.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#341553 is 0.24, 0.14, 0.14 and YIQ Color Space of #341553 is 37.337, -1.4477, 25.8509.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#341553 is 1.83, 0.97, 8.28.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#341553 is 14.9, 29.1, -31.8.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#341553 is 14.9, 6.06, -32.65.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#341553 is 14.9, 43.11, 312.46. Hunter Lab variable of #341553 is 13.75, 18.14, -26.52.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#341553

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
